- Condition is an additional condition ?The SAP error message
/SAPCND/ANALYSIS005 Condition is an additional condition
typically occurs in the context of condition management, particularly when working with pricing conditions in SAP. This error indicates that the system has identified a condition that is classified as an "additional condition," which may not be properly configured or is conflicting with existing conditions.Cause:
- Condition Type Configuration: The condition type may be set up incorrectly in the system. It might be defined as an additional condition when it should not be.
- Condition Records: There may be issues with the condition records associated with the condition type, such as missing or incorrect entries.
- Condition Exclusion: The system may be trying to apply a condition that is excluded from the pricing procedure or is not allowed to be combined with other conditions.
- Pricing Procedure: The pricing procedure may not be configured to handle additional conditions properly, leading to conflicts.
Solution:
Check Condition Type Configuration:
- Go to the configuration settings for the condition type in transaction
SPRO
.- Ensure that the condition type is set up correctly and that it is intended to be an additional condition if that is the requirement.
Review Condition Records:
- Use transaction
VK11
orVK12
to check the condition records for the specific condition type.- Ensure that all necessary records are created and that they are valid for the relevant sales documents.
Examine Pricing Procedure:
- Check the pricing procedure assigned to the sales document type in transaction
V/08
.- Ensure that the additional condition is included in the pricing procedure and that it is configured correctly.
